Re: LJ abolishing free accounts, for those who want more info
Date: 2008-03-13 04:59 am (UTC)Basic Accounts
Basic Account is an option available to accounts which were created before March 12, 2008. No account created after this date can be turned into a Basic Account. Basic Accounts will not have any advertising displayed on their accounts, but will have fewer benefits and features. A Basic Account includes the following:
* Upload up to 6 userpics
* 25 subscriptions for notification of new posts, friends, comments, or events
In conclusion, if you have a free account with no ads, LJ is not making you choose between leaving, having ads, or giving them money. Which is something. But if you want to create a new journal, you do need to either put up with ads or give them money.
